Chionodes fumatella

(Douglas, 1850)


Wingspan c. 15mm.

Fairly well distributed in England and Wales, and reaching parts of eastern Scotland, this species was until fairly recently restricted to sandy coastal locations, but nowadays can be found quite a distance inland.

The flight time of the adults is from June to August, and the species can be attracted to light.

The larval stages are not very well described, but mosses are believed to be the foodplants.
